Method for supporting handover in mobile communication network
Abstract:
The present disclosure relates to a pre-5th-Generation (5G) or 5G communication system to be provided for supporting higher data rates Beyond 4th-Generation (4G) communication system such as Long Term Evolution (LTE). According to embodiments, an access and mobility management function (AMF) comprises at least one transceiver; and at least one processor, wherein the at least one processor is configured to receive, a mobility management entity (MME) for an evolved node B (eNB), a message associated with a handover required message for an inter-system handover from an evolved packet system (EPS) to 5G system (5GS) with a secondary gNB (SgNB) used as a target next generation node B (gNB), wherein the SgNB and the target gNB are co-located and the eNB is associated with the SgNB in a dual connectivity; transmit, to the target gNB, a handover request message for the inter-system handover from the EPS to 5GS with the SgNB used as the target gNB; and receive, from the target gNB, an acknowledge of the handover request message. The handover required message includes an SgNB user equipment (UE) X2 application protocol ID (SgNB UE X2AP ID) for identifying a UE over X2 interface in the SgNB. The handover request message includes the SgNB UE X2AP ID, and the SgNB UE X2AP ID is allocated at the SgNB.
